Ijen's Blue Flame Dance: A Volcano Awakens
Deep within the caldera of Indonesia's Mount Ijen, a spectacle unfolds that shatters all expectations. Amidst the smoldering earth and billowing sulfur clouds, an otherworldly blue flame sparks with hypnotic intensity. This astonishing display is a testament to the raw power of nature, where volcanic activity intertwines with chemical wonder.
Explorers from around the world are drawn to this awe-inspiring phenomenon, eager to witness the dance of the blue flames against the backdrop of a starlit sky. The Ijen crater is a realm of contrasts, where the air is thick with sulfurous fumes and the ground glows with an eerie, ethereal light.
Climbing into this volcanic underworld requires courage and preparation, but the reward is a truly memorable experience. The blue flames are a constant reminder of the power and mystery that lies hidden beneath the surface of our world.
Tumpak Sewu: The Waterfall Symphony of Fire
Nestled deep within the verdant embrace of Indonesia's East Java, lies a spectacle that enchants the senses. Tumpak Sewu, meaning "Thousand Cascades," is a natural wonder where myriad of cascading waterfalls plunge into a turquoise pool below. The air reverberates with the thunderous roar of water as it crashes gravity, creating a symphony of sound that echoes through the surrounding forest.
Legend tells of fiery creatures dwelling within these falls, their presence lending a mystical hue to the cascading water. The sun's rays often reflect through the misty spray, creating an ethereal panorama of colors that paint the scene in hues of gold, red, and azure.
